With Amy Poehler leaving the show for motherhood and Tina Fey's brief return as Sarah Palin over, Saturday Night Live was severely lacking in estrogen.  According to the New York Times, Saturday Night Live has added two new female cast member to replace them.

Abby Elliott (left) and Michaela Watkins (right) will join the cast on Saturday as regular cast members.  Elliott is from Wilton, Connecticut and performed with the improve group the Upright Citizen Brigade.  Watkins is from Syracuse and is an actress and sketch artist who trained with the Groundlings improv group.

According to excutive producer, Lorne Michaels, SNL will be adding more cast members later this season.  The question is, will these ladies be enough for SNL now that hte political material is gone?
